Summary:In this episode, we explore how the APT10 subgroup “MirrorFace” abused the Windows Sandbox feature to establish stealthy persistence. By enabling and configuring the sandbox remotely, they launched malware designed to run only inside that isolated environment, avoiding detection entirely.

Defensive Recommendations:

  • Disable Windows Sandbox if not in use organization-wide
  • Monitor for sudden sandbox activation or system reboots with feature changes
  • Watch for background execution of wsb.exe or sandbox-related memory activity
  • Use memory forensics to inspect vmmemWindowsSandbox or vmmem processes
  • Apply AppLocker or similar policies to prevent unauthorized sandbox usage
  • Detect Tor-based outbound connections from host IPs

Artifacts and Tools to Watch:

  • Windows Sandbox configuration changes or sudden feature activations
  • Usage of wsb.exe from unknown users or automation scripts
  • Scripts unpacking archives or scheduling hidden tasks within the sandbox
  • Shared folder usage between host and sandbox environments
  • Sandbox memory processes exposing RAT or C2 tool signatures
